Earnings for Educational Administration Graduates from McKendree University

Graduates of McKendree University’s Educational Administration program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Educational Administration at McKendree University
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$52,780
2 years $45,500
3 years $45,492
4 years $51,113
5 years $56,034

How does this compare to the school overall? Four years out, Educational Administration graduates from McKendree University take home a median $51,113, compared with $64,231 for all McKendree University graduates — about 20% lower than the school-wide median.

Educational Administration Master’s Program at McKendree University

Among the 32 master’s educational administration graduates at McKendree University, 72% were women (23) and 28% were men (9).

McKendree University gender breakdown of Educational Administration Master's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Educational Administration master’s degree recipients at McKendree University.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 25
Black / African American 5
Unknown 2
Racial-ethnic diversity of Educational Administration majors at McKendree University

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 16% of Educational Administration master’s degree recipients at McKendree University, below the national average of 35%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
